Certificate in Public Diplomacy and Political Warfare

The purpose of this certificate is to provide specialized study of two unconventional and often misunderstood tools of statecraft – public diplomacy and political warfare – and to provide a starting point for the practitioner to integrate them with each other and with other instruments of policy. This program is the only one of its kind in the United States.

Economic Statecraft and Conflict

In most international affairs curricula, economics is taught with a principal focus on trade, economic development, foreign aid, and international finance. What is frequently missing is that dimension of economics which concerns national security policy. This course covers that dimension.
